That is the ACV. It directs air from the air pump to either the exhaust ports, the main catalytic converter, or to the mysterious airbox hose that goes nowhere. Don't remove the ACV if you ever hope to pass a emissions test. If you're not worried about that, then you can also remove the airpump, the pre-catalytic converter (you should have replaced this with a downpipe by now), the main catalytic comverter (either gut it or put in midpipe), and all associated tubing and solenoids.
